MT13 RJJ is a 2013 Hyundai I20 in Silver with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.

Across all 2013 Hyundai I20 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.3% with a typical mileage of 46,025 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Hyundai I20 f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 6,256 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MT13 RJJ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Hyundai I20 typically stays on UK roads for around 17 years. At 13 years old, this Hyundai I20 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
